Temple of the Wind
Temple of the Wind is a temple in Tulum Municipality, Quintana Roo. Access is restricted and requires permission. Temple of the Wind is situated nearby to the ruins House of the Cenote, as well as near Plataforma.- Access is restricted and requires permission.
- Type: Temple
- Also known as: “Templo del Dios del Viento”

Tulum is the largest community in the municipality of Tulum, Quintana Roo, Mexico. It is located on the Caribbean coast of the state, near the site of the archaeological ruins of Tulum. Tulum is situated 3½ km west of Temple of the Wind.
